When Marvel vs. Capcom Fighting Collection: Arcade Classics was announced by Capcom in 2024, many fans immediately noticed the absence of an Xbox release. Instead, the game was set to launch on PlayStation 4, Nintendo Switch, and PC on September 12, 2024, leaving Xbox fighting game fans understandably frustrated, but due to technical reasons, it was understood. Then, of course, Capcom released that doing so was a mistake and vowed to make things right, and today they have.
Capcom has finally addressed this issue. During the Capcom Spotlight event on February 4, 2025, the company announced that Marvel vs. Capcom Fighting Collection: Arcade Classics is now available on Xbox. While it’s a digital-only release, it at least ensures that Xbox players no longer feel left out.
The collection includes seven classic games:
- The Punisher
- X-Men: Children of the Atom
- Marvel Super Heroes
- X-Men vs. Street Fighter
- Marvel Super Heroes vs. Street Fighter
- Marvel vs. Capcom: Clash of the Super Heroes
- Marvel vs. Capcom 2: New Age of Heroes
We reviewed Marvel vs. Capcom Fighting Collection: Arcade Classics and found it to be an excellent effort by Capcom, despite the lack of crossplay. Every game is arcade-perfect, with no missing features, plenty of fan service, and rollback netcode for smooth online play.
